We are pleased to announce that the winner of the Agronomy 2022 Young Investigator Award is Dr. Leontina Lipan.

Dr. Leontina Lipan is a Junior Researcher at Universidad Miguel Hernández (UMH, Spain), currently conducting a 2-year research stay at the Institute of Agrifood Research and Technology (IRTA, Spain), and she is also an external professor at the Universitat Rovira i Virgili for the subject Integrated Laboratory of Unit Operations in the food industry. Her work has engaged everything from the sustainability of water resources in almond crops to the effect of deficit irrigation on fruit quality. Nowadays, in IRTA, she is involved in projects related to (i) genetic improvements of almond cultivars better adapted to climate change; (ii) advanced techniques to predict the behavior of nuts (almonds, hazelnuts) in industrialization processes; (iii) development of fraud detection tools for Spanish nuts with a high risk of counterfeiting; (iv) valorization of mountain hazelnuts and almonds from rural areas; among others. As a result of the research activity so far, Leontina (i) was invited to 4 plenary conferences, and she was awarded with the “Best Speaker Award” in one of them organized by Foods, (ii) she is topic and guest editor of many Special Issues related to agrifood science, and (iii) she published 40 scientific articles in high-impact peer-reviewed journals, 4 teaching articles, 4 scientific dissemination articles, and 6 book chapters.

As the awardee, Dr. Leontina Lipan will receive an honorarium of CHF 2000, an offer to publish a paper free of charge before 31 December 2023 in Agronomy after peer-review, and an engraved plaque.
